Coronavirus: Coronaviru curfew extended in Andhra Pradesh till May 31, with more than 20,000 new cases coming every day

New Delhi, 17 May 2021 Monday

The Andhra Pradesh government has decided to extend the already imposed coro curfew till May 31 in view of the rapid increase in corona transition cases in the state. A government order on Monday said, "Corona curfew is in force in the state from May 5 from 12 noon to 6 am, which was to end on Tuesday (May 18), but Chief Minister Y. S Jagan Mohan Reddy has decided to extend the curfew till May 31 at a high-level meeting to review the epidemic.

The chief minister instructed officials, "The curfew should be for at least four weeks to break the chain of corona transition, so continue." According to a press release issued by the Chief Minister's Office, Jagan Mohan Reddy has asked health officials to take steps to reduce the number of cases of infection in rural areas. The chief minister has told officials to take special care of children who have lost their lives to covid.
